windbg修改进程id
时间: 2024-06-15 19:09:50 浏览: 6
Windbg是一款由微软开发的调试工具,可以用于分析和调试Windows操作系统和应用程序。在Windbg中修改进程ID可以通过以下步骤实现:
1. 打开Windbg,并选择“文件”->“附加到进程”。
2. 在弹出的对话框中,输入要调试的进程ID,并点击“附加”按钮。
3. Windbg会连接到指定的进程,并显示相关的调试信息。
4. 在Windbg的命令行中,可以使用一些命令来修改进程ID,例如:
- `.attach <进程ID>`:附加到指定的进程。
- `.detach`:从当前附加的进程中分离。
- `.kill`:终止当前附加的进程。
需要注意的是,修改进程ID可能会对正在运行的进程产生影响,请谨慎操作。
相关问题
windbg分析进程卡死
Windbg是一种Windows调试工具,用于分析进程的崩溃、卡死或其他异常情况。当进程卡死时,可以通过以下步骤使用Windbg进行分析:
1. 打开Windbg并运行进程:在Windbg界面中,选择 "File" -> "Attach to Process",选择要分析的进程并点击 "OK"。
2. 设置符号路径:在Windbg命令行中输入 ".symfix" 命令,设置符号路径以获取正确的调试符号。
3. 获取进程堆栈信息:在Windbg命令行中输入 "kb" 命令,获取当前线程的堆栈信息。根据堆栈信息可以确定进程卡死的位置。
4. 分析卡死原因:根据堆栈信息中的函数调用顺序和参数值,可以推断出导致进程卡死的原因。常见的原因可能包括死锁、内存泄漏、无限循环等。
5. 分析资源使用:使用Windbg的内存和对象查看器,获取进程的内存使用情况和对象分配情况。这可以帮助确定是否有内存泄漏等问题。
6. 分析线程状态:使用Windbg的线程查看器,查看各个线程的状态、堆栈和寄存器信息。根据线程的状态可以推断出是否存在线程间竞争或死锁等问题。
通过以上步骤,可以初步定位进程卡死的原因,并采取相应的调试或优化措施。需要注意的是Windbg是一款强大的调试工具,需要一定的调试经验和对操作系统的了解,才能有效地分析进程卡死问题。
windbg preview
Windbg Preview是一款由微软开发的调试工具,它是Windows操作系统的一部分。它主要用于分析和调试应用程序、内核模式驱动程序以及操作系统本身的问题。Windbg Preview相比于传统的Windbg具有更加现代化的用户界面和更多的功能。
Windbg Preview具有以下特点和功能:
1. 支持多种调试目标:可以调试用户模式和内核模式下的应用程序、驱动程序以及操作系统。
2. 强大的调试功能:提供了丰富的调试命令和功能,如断点设置、变量查看、堆栈跟踪等,可以帮助开发人员快速定位和解决问题。
3. 支持多种调试扩展:可以通过加载扩展插件来扩展Windbg Preview的功能,如Python扩展、JavaScript扩展等。
4. 支持远程调试:可以通过网络连接远程调试目标,方便在不同环境下进行调试。
5. 支持脚本自动化:可以使用脚本语言编写自动化脚本,提高调试效率。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)